WebSep 24, 2024 · But thankfully, the Siamese cat has a single-layer coat type. The single-layer coats are already shed less than the double-layer coat types. Does Siamese undergo yearly shedding? Yes, just like many other furry animals, Siamese cats also undergo two moults a year. They shed during the spring and fall. WebFeb 11, 2024 · A Siamese cat will only shed in Spring or Fall when preparing their bodies for the heat or cold. But a Siamese cat can shed year-round if it is used to staying indoors. All cats can lose track of the seasons when they do not go out as much. Allowing a Siamese cat to go out regularly will help minimize the shedding.
